Speaker 1 (00:00):
And an exclusive interview with David Bassey for Dodger Talk.

Speaker 2 (00:06):
We're live in Seattle at t Mobile Park after the
Dodgers hold on for a big win three to two,
and I'm with tonight's first baseman who smelled the RBI
and he drove in the go ahead run, the insurance
run that turned out to be the difference, and that's
Dalton Rushing. Let's start with that ninth inning. You're a catcher.
What are you thinking as far as just trying to

(00:28):
think along with Tanner and Ben?

Speaker 1 (00:30):
Yeah, I think I think Ben did a great job.
Tanner kept himself composed up there, ran into some traffic,
but uh, that's all you got to do in that role,
and you're gonna have some traffic sometimes. And for him
to be able to stay under control and do his
thing out there and get some swinging mess it was massive.
It was good to see.

Speaker 2 (00:47):
You've been contributing all season long in San Diego. Big
three run home run to help you guys win tonight.
He got a couple of singles. How good does it
feel to get an opportunity and deliver?

Speaker 1 (00:58):
Yeah, it feels great. This is the baseball everyone prays for.
This is what you want to do. You want to
play in games like this, You want to play in
atmospheres like this, and uh, if you're not a guy
that wants the opportunity every single time you want to,
I guess you could say spotlight. Yeah, it's gonna be
tough to succeed here.

Speaker 2 (01:15):
How happy are you to be part of a division championship?
You've watched the Dodgers celebrate, you were part of it
last night.

Speaker 1 (01:21):
Yeah, it's Uh, it was pretty special obviously, my first
division championship with the team, and uh, to be able
to just be around these guys honestly, day in day out,
it makes it a little more special at the end
of the day.

Speaker 2 (01:32):
Hey, Dalton, great job tonight. Maybe I'll let Freddy know
he's been Wally pipped.

Speaker 1 (01:38):
Yeah he's Uh. I guess he's taught me well over time.
Thanks David,
